Advertisements Verizon is pushing a maintenance update to Droid Pro. It contains some bug fixes and improvements. Update Changelog: Improved audio on voice calls. Improved stability and performance. User interface display now refreshes when user switches from GSM/UMTS communication to Global Mode. Device now prepends 011 to Country Code to send SMS messages. Global Mode […]

Advertisements Enable Table NFC is the first commercial restaurant application to support Near Field Communications (NFC) technology on the Android market. Enable Table NFC allows the Nexus S user to touch their phone, at the end of a meal, to an Enable Table NFC Check Billfold and receive Welcome Back Coupons directly to their Nexus […]
